- Turkish President Tayyip Erdogan is threatening to scrap a refugee deal with the European Union just 24 hours after he met Germany's Angela Merkel on the sidelines of a U.N. conference in Istanbul.
- What went wrong? Erdogan feels the EU isn't keeping its word on financial aid and shouldn't constantly impose criteria in return for pledged visa-free travel for Turkish citizens.
- "I don't want to comment as I've only just learned of it from press reports,” German Interior Minister Thomas de Maiziere told reporters.
